Cookie Policy„  

Cookies and other tracking technologies may be used on the Nakiteu website in various ways, e.g., to enable the website to function, for traffic analysis, or for marketing purposes. 
A cookie is a small piece of data that a website stores on a visitor’s computer or mobile device. A cookie allows the website to „remember“ actions of the visitor from previous visits. Most browsers allow the use of cookies, but the user can delete them at any time or set the browser to block them. The most common reasons for using cookies are: identifying visitors, remembering specific user preferences, assisting with the entry of information previously entered during earlier visits, collecting data for analysis, and promotional campaigns. 
Cookies can be classified as: 
Session cookies – stored on the computer and automatically deleted after the web browser is closed. They enable the website to obtain temporary data, such as comments or shopping‑cart status for purchases.

Persistent cookies – Remain in your web browser after it is closed and usually have an expiration date. Nakiteu uses persistent cookies to facilitate access for registered users. They store data such as username and password, enabling the „remember me“ functionality during login so you do not have to enter your username and password each time you visit nakit.eu. 
First‑party cookie – These come from the website you visited and can be either temporary or permanent. They allow websites to store data that is used when the user returns to the site. Third‑party cookies – Several external services store limited cookies for the user (Facebook, Instagram, Google Analytics and AdWords).
These cookies are not set by Nakiteu and are typically used to help interpret user behavior and for marketing purposes. 
What options are available to you?  
In the settings of browsers such as Internet Explorer, Safari, Firefox, or Chrome you can specify which cookies you want to accept and which you will reject. The location of these settings depends on the type of your browser. Use the „Help“ option in your browser to find the settings you need. 
 If you choose not to accept certain cookies, you may not be able to use some features on the nakit.eu website.
